什么是devActivity?
devActivity是一个旨在提升软件开发体验的尖端分析平台。通过利用人工智能的力量,它为开发人员和工程团队提供了关于他们贡献和表现的宝贵洞察。该工具与GitHub无缝集成,提供了一系列功能,包括绩效评估、回顾性洞察和运营警报,所有这些都旨在优化工作流程并提高生产力。
devActivity的一个突出特点是引入了游戏化元素。通过引入XP分数、成就和排行榜,该平台在团队成员之间培养了健康的竞争和参与。这不仅使开发过程更加愉快,还鼓励持续改进和协作。
透明度和责任制是devActivity设计的核心。该平台帮助团队识别开发过程中的瓶颈,从而实现更好的决策和更高效的资源分配。重要的是,devActivity非常重视用户隐私,只收集非敏感的Git元数据,不访问源代码。
devActivity采用免费增值模式运营,为用户提供免费访问基本功能的机会,同时为那些寻求更高级功能的用户提供付费功能。这种方法使其适用于各种规模和预算的团队,使强大的开发分析工具变得更加普及。
devActivity的特点
devActivity拥有一系列令人印象深刻的功能,旨在简化软件开发过程并提高团队绩效。让我们深入了解一些主要功能:
- 数据驱动的绩效评估:这一功能彻底改变了团队进行绩效评估的方式。通过分析GitHub活动,包括贡献、拉取请求和代码审查,devActivity提供了关于个人和团队绩效的全面洞察。这种数据驱动的方法有助于识别需要改进的领域,并认可杰出的贡献。
- AI驱动的回顾性洞察:利用人工智能,devActivity在团队回顾中提供可操作的洞察。通过分析过去的绩效数据,它突出显示趋势并提出改进建议,确保团队根据具体数据而不是主观印象不断改进他们的实践。
- 贡献和工作质量分析:该平台监控与贡献相关的各种指标,如提交频率和拉取请求响应速度。这一功能帮助团队保持高标准的工作质量,并快速解决可能需要注意的任何领域。
- 运营瓶颈警报:devActivity主动识别并提醒团队工作流程中的潜在障碍,如代码审查延迟或停滞的拉取请求。这一功能对于保持项目动力和满足截止日期至关重要。
- 游戏化元素:通过引入XP、等级、挑战和排行榜等元素,devActivity使开发过程更具吸引力和动力。这种健康的竞争可以提升团队士气和生产力。
devActivity如何工作?
devActivity的核心是通过与GitHub无缝集成并跟踪各种开发活动来运作。这包括监控提交、拉取请求和问题管理,为团队提供详细的性能指标可见性,无需手动输入数据。
devActivity的魔力在于其AI驱动的功能。该平台分析开发模式,识别瓶颈,并提供可操作的建议以提高效率。这使工程经理和开发人员能够优化他们的工作流程,确保项目保持正轨并交付高质量的结果。
通过将原始数据转化为有意义的洞察,devActivity使团队更容易跟踪进度、分析性能并实施持续改进的策略。在竞争激烈的软件行业中,效率和质量至关重要,这种数据驱动的方法是无价的。
devActivity的好处
使用devActivity的好处是众多且影响深远的:
- 增强绩效评估:数据驱动的绩效评估方法帮助团队客观地识别优势和劣势,培养持续改进的文化。
- 改进回顾:AI驱动的洞察使回顾更加富有成效,基于过去的表现提供可操作的建议。
- 提高透明度:通过全面的贡献和工作质量分析,开发人员可以完全了解他们的产出,从而做出更好的决策。
- 主动解决问题:运营瓶颈警报允许团队在潜在延迟成为重大问题之前解决它们。
- 提高参与度:游戏化元素为生产力引入了有趣的竞争边缘,激励团队成员并提高整体参与度。
- 优化工作流程:通过提供洞察和建议,devActivity帮助团队简化流程并提高效率。
devActivity的替代品
虽然devActivity提供了独特的功能集,但市场上还有几种替代品满足开发者生产力和参与度的不同方面:
- Showwcase:一个供开发者连接、分享知识和展示项目的社交网络。它通过付费订阅提供盈利选择。
- Pluralsight:专注于技能发展,拥有大量的技术和创意培训课程,为开发者提供结构化的学习路径。
- GitHub个人网站生成器:允许开发者创建展示其GitHub贡献和经验的个人网站。
- CodeClimate:提供自动化代码审查和质量指标,使团队能够保持高编码标准并提高整体代码质量。
- SonarQube:分析代码质量和安全漏洞,提供详细的报告和建议,帮助开发者编写更干净、更安全的代码。
虽然这些替代品提供了有价值的功能,但devActivity以其全面的开发分析和团队优化方法脱颖而出。通过结合AI驱动的洞察和游戏化元素,devActivity为寻求增强软件开发流程的团队提供了独特的解决方案。
总之,devActivity代表了软件开发分析的重大进步。其创新的性能跟踪方法,结合AI驱动的洞察和引人入胜的游戏化元素,使其成为寻求优化工作流程和提高生产力的团队的强大工具。随着软件行业的不断发展,像devActivity这样的工具无疑将在塑造未来的开发实践中发挥关键作用。